Abstract

We describe a simple class of cosmological models called $\ensuremath{\alpha}$-attractors, which provide an excellent fit to the latest Planck data. These theories are most naturally formulated in the context of supergravity with logarithmic K\"ahler potentials. We develop generalized versions of these models which can describe not only inflation but also dark energy and supersymmetry breaking.
